The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.

The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.

Date of Patent:
Jun. 13, 2023

Filed:

Aug. 28, 2020
Applicant:

Hangzhou Dptech Technologies Co., Ltd., Zhejiang Province, CN;

Inventors:

Yan Mi, Zhejiang, CN;

Zhe Wang, Zhejiang, CN;

Assignee:
Attorney:
Primary Examiner:
Int. Cl.
CPC ...
H04L 9/40 (2022.01); G06F 11/07 (2006.01); H04L 45/74 (2022.01);
U.S. Cl.
CPC ...
H04L 63/1425 (2013.01); G06F 11/076 (2013.01); G06F 11/0709 (2013.01); H04L 45/74 (2013.01);
Abstract

Methods for counting synchronization (SYN) packets to identify a SYN attack, applicable to network device, are provided. The network device includes a field programmable gate array (FPGA) for counting the total number of received SYN packets and a high-speed hardware memory connected to the FPGA. One of the methods includes: periodically traversing the count entries stored in the high-speed hardware memory, and aging any count entry for which a time difference between a current time and a creation time reaches a preset aging time interval; obtaining a first number of SYN packets and a second number of SYN packets; and updating the total number of the received SYN packets with a sum of the first number of SYN packets and the second number of SYN packets.


Find Patent Forward Citations

Loading…